HOW MANY ALFA ROMEO MITO TWINAIR ARE LEFT?

There are 235 ALFA ROMEO MITO TWINAIR left on the road in the UK (i.e. with valid road tax). There are a further 8 ALFA ROMEO MITO TWINAIR that are currently SORNED.

The total number of ALFA ROMEO MITO TWINAIR was highest during 2023 Q2 (252). The number taxed topped out in 2023 Q1 and the total SORNed was at its maximum during 2025 Q2.

Since the total peaked, some 9 (4%) ALFA ROMEO MITO TWINAIR have been scrapped or exported.

The 5 year trend shows a total decline of 5 ALFA ROMEO MITO TWINAIR models. Taxed models have declined by 10 and the SORNed total has increased by 5.

97% of the surviving 243 ALFA ROMEO MITO TWINAIR in the UK are still on the road.
